Do not store default values in user's QgsSettings
The new behavior is to store a value in user's QSettings (that overrides the global settings) only if the the value has changed from the default reported by QgsSettings. If a value was changed and it is changed back to the default the override must be removed from the user settings. The rationale is that global settings should be the ultimate source of default values, unless the user override the default with a different value. Fixes #21049
